From controlling change to facilitating it

Change Management has perhaps traditionally been a control mindset.

But what would happen if we shifted our stance from one of control to facilitation?

We can do this with the following:

šŸ’” ā€˜define and align’ behind clear change outcomes, via great conversations starting at Exec level, around a ā€˜change canvas’

šŸ¤ help leaders to ā€˜lead when they don’t know’ – with people and dialogue at the heart, creating space for colleagues to co-create solutions

šŸŒ think ā€˜shared outcomes over silos’ and bridge different, and equally valid, perspectives relating to the change

šŸ› ļø create change plans together with impacted colleagues…and early

šŸ”„ test, measure and learn, adapting our approach based on the complexities of each organisation, all the while thinking ā€˜progress over perfection’ (that’s our favourite)
